Problem
Natural and synthetic high-potency sweeteners disrupt the temporal and flavor profiles of food compositions, leading to unbalanced taste experiences due to differences in onset, duration, and adaptation behaviors compared to sugar, necessitating re-balancing of flavor components and posing challenges in expanding the variety of sweetened products.
Innovation Solution
Development of functional sweetener compositions combining high-potency sweeteners with anti-inflammatory agents and sweet taste improving compositions to modify the temporal and flavor profiles, making them more sugar-like, thereby enhancing the versatility of sweetened products.

The present invention relates generally to functional sweetener compositions comprising non-caloric or low-caloric high-potency sweeteners and methods for making and using them. In particular, the present invention relates to different functional sweetener compositions comprising at least one non-caloric or low-caloric natural and/or synthetic high potency sweetener, at least one sweet taste improving composition, and at least one functional ingredient, such as an anti-inflammatory agent. The present invention also relates to functional sweetener compositions and methods that can improve the tastes of non-caloric or low-caloric natural and/or synthetic high-potency sweeteners by imparting a more sugar-like taste or characteristic. In particular, the functional sweetener compositions and methods provide a more sugar-like temporal profile, including sweetness onset and sweetness linger, and/or a more sugar-like flavor profile.
